Rosella recover output (bins vs. refined bins)

Open Rridley7 opened this issue 11 months ago • 0 comments

Hello, I recently updated this tool and had a few questions about the new rosella recover bins output. Within an output folder, I see bins marked as refined, and other ones not noted as such. There are additionally runs I have where there are only non-refined bins. There is also numeric overlap at times between these bins. From what I understand, a single round of rosella refine is now run during the recover workflow? Also is there any significance to the numeric overlap btwn refined and non-refined?

I am using this in a pipeline which subsequently passes to dastool for refinement, so would you say the 'refined' bins are captured within the regular ones? I.e., would you recommend passing the normal bins, refined bins, or both on to subsequent steps?
